introduzione
Cheat è uno strumento di promemoria dei comandi basato su Python. Rispetto alle pagine man e info lunghe e vaghe, cheat fornisce istruzioni distinte su opzioni, argomenti o usi comuni di comandi comuni. Con cheat, gli amministratori di sistema possono anche modificare cheat sheet esistenti o creare cheat sheet personalizzati per qualsiasi argomento.
Cheat può essere installato su tutti i tipi di sistemi simili a Unix. In questo articolo, mostrerò solo i passaggi su un'istanza del server CentOS.
Prerequisiti
Prima di procedere, devi:
- Distribuire un'istanza del server CentOS con l'applicazione Vultr LEMP.
- Accedi come utente non root con autorizzazioni sudo. In questo tutorial puoi scoprire come creare un tale utente .
Fase 1: installare pip e cheat
Il modo più semplice per installare cheat è con pip:
sudo yum update
sudo yum install -y python-devel python-setuptools python-pip
sudo pip install --upgrade pip
sudo pip install cheat
Modifica il .bashrcfile dell'utente corrente per specificare l'editor predefinito per la modifica dei cheat sheet e per abilitare l'evidenziazione della sintassi:
vi ~/.bashrc
Aggiungi le seguenti due righe sotto la riga "fi":
export EDITOR=/usr/bin/vim
export CHEATCOLORS=true
Salva ed esci:
:wq
Metti in atto le modifiche:
source ~/.bashrc
Passaggio tre: utilizzare cheat
Per visualizzare un cheat sheet:
cheat [xyz]
[xyz] è il nome del comando che si desidera interrogare.
Per cercare un cheat sheet incluso il tuo input [xyz]:
cheat -s [xyz]
Tutti i contenuti correlati nei cheat sheet che includono la frase [xyz]verranno visualizzati sullo schermo.
Per elencare tutti i cheat sheet disponibili:
cheat -l
Per modificare un cheat sheet esistente o per creare un cheat sheet personalizzato:
cheat -e [xyz]
Per vedere la versione del programma cheat:
cheat -v
Per vedere le posizioni dei negozi di cheat sheet:
cheat -d